Heat Resistant Silicon Carbide Refractory Plates (SSIC/RBSIC/SIC) are engineered ceramic parts designed for high-temperature applications in industrial environments. Crafted from silicon carbide (SIC) ceramic, these plates deliver exceptional heat resistance, structural integrity, and chemical stability, making them ideal for furnace fixtures, kiln components, and refractory systems.
